Georgia election official: Effort to overturn 2020 results will drive down runoff turnout

Source: Politico | December 3, 2020 | Quint Forgey

“At this point, there’s no way that it can’t,” said Gabriel Sterling, the state’s voting system implementation manager.

Gabriel Sterling, a top Georgia election official, predicted Thursday that attorneys working to overturn the state’s election results on President Donald Trump’s behalf will drive down voter turnout in runoff races early next year that will determine which party controls the Senate.

“At this point, there’s no way that it can’t,” Sterling, Georgia’s voting system implementation manager, told CNN — referring to the conspiratorial claims that pro-Trump attorneys Sidney Powell and Lin Wood have leveled this week in defense of the president’s effort to reverse the outcome of the 2020 White House race.

Sterling’s remarks echo Republican anxieties that Trump’s quixotic bid to undo his election defeat, as well as his baseless allegations of widespread voter fraud, could blunt GOP support for Georgia Sens. Kelly Loeffler and David Perdue, who are both competing in January runoffs that will decide whether Democrats are able to retake the Senate.

At a rally on Wednesday, Powell and Wood solicited donations and urged Republican voters against casting their ballots for the two senators, arguing that Loeffler and Perdue — both ardent Trump allies — had been insufficiently supportive of the president.

“I think I would encourage all Georgians to make it known that you will not vote at all until your vote is secure,” Powell said.

“They have not earned your vote. Don’t you give it to them,” Wood added. “Why would you go back and vote in another rigged election, for God’s sake!”

Asked on Thursday what exactly was behind Powell and Wood’s efforts to discourage support for Georgia’s two Republican senators, Sterling said: “Who the heck knows? I mean, it’s ‘Looney Tunes.’ … I’m speechless. That’s the best I’ve got right now.”
